Have faced / do face a similar issue regularly. My vehicle lies in the sun while at office and when leaving in the afternoon, the front left window often fails to roll down. Tried both switches, that on the left side as well as the one on the drivers side console.

A few minutes after I start driving and the window tends to roll down when attempted on either switch, without any other intervention.

I suspect that the beading into which the glass rests gets sticky due to the heat, thereby holding onto the glass and once the AC runs for a couple of minutes, things cool down enough and lets the glass go.

Either that or the winder motor for the glass is affected by the heat.

This started to happen probably after around 35-36k.

Planning to get it checked in a couple of weeks when the car goes in for the 40k service. @39k now.

Got the 40k service done.

Window stuck issue - The advisor mentioned that the beading on the window was fine. The problem was with the motor for the window. Can't say that I was convinced by that since the issue occurs only at a specific time of day, unless the issue is manifested due to ambient heat. Anyway, the part is under order so that it can be replaced under warranty.

The drive belt had also started fraying, so got that replaced as well.

Strangest issue faced - I had noticed some dis-coloured spotting in the crevice below the rear windshield and asked the advisor about it. The service manager offered to have it checked and offered to repaint if there was any evidence of rusting. Surprisingly, it was rust. Not sure how it is rusting from inside. Got the tailgate repainted FOC and got the bumpers repainted as well (paid) to cover the bruises of travelling in the city over close to 3 years.

Overall service cost including drive belt replacement was INR 6200.

Service Update - 50k

My major concern this time was:
1) Try a new service station (Even though I had tried a new HASS last time which was satisfactory, I had a terrible experience with the i10. So decided to switch to a different dealer).
2) Front suspension had this thud sound coming each time I drive over an uneven surface.

It was a normal service carried out except for the suspension issue mentioned above. Changed the link stabilizer under warranty which rectified this issue. Even though I used to skip the engine bay dressing and AC disinfectant, I decided to do it this time as my daily route is pretty dusty. The total bill came to around 10k.

Service center experience (VTJ Hyundai) was pretty good as well. The SA didn't push for any unwanted items and even pointed some "to-do" replacements which he said can be done next time. The best part was the wait time which was nil. My average wait time was close to 30 mins to 1 hour in the previous dealership. Definitely going back there only.
